Leinster confirm Croke Park as venue for Munster derby

Croke Park was a sell-out for last season's Interprovincial clash

Leinster have confirmed that next season's BKT URC derby against Munster will be held at Croke Park.

With the RDS under redevelopment, Leinster are using Aviva Stadium and Croke Park as their home grounds.

Last season’s Leinster-Munster clash was also held at Jones’s Road with over 80,000 in attendance at the home of the Gaelic Athletic Association.

James Lowe, Caelan Doris, Hugo Keenan and RG Snyman all scored in a 26-12 win for the hosts.

The fixture will take place in round four on Saturday 18 October at 5.15pm, with tickets on sale to the public on 29 August.

Leo Cullen’s side, who beat Bulls in last season’s finale to win their first silverware since 2021, are away to Stormers and Bulls in their opening two fixtures before hosting Sharks in Aviva Stadium on 11 October, and Clayton McMillan’s Munster a week later.

Leinster have said that they will return to the RDS for the start of the 2026/27 season.

They will play most of their home games this season at the Aviva with some games designated for Croke Park.
